Daqo New Energy Corp. (DQ) Stock: A Closer Look at the Analyst Ratings
Daqo New Energy Corp. (NYSE: DQ) has a price-to-earnings ratio of 2.80x that is above its average ratio. Additionally, the 36-month beta value for DQ is 0.53. There are mixed opinions on the stock, with 3 analysts rating it as a “buy,” 1 rating it as “overweight,” 5 rating it as “hold,” and 1 rating it as “sell.”
The average price predicted by analysts for DQ is $42.18, which is $11.43 above the current price. The public float for DQ is 69.87M and currently, short sellers hold a 4.93% ratio of that float. The average trading volume of DQ on September 01, 2023 was 930.39K shares.

DQ’s Market Performance
DQ’s stock has risen by 4.26% in the past week, with a monthly rise of 2.55% and a quarterly drop of -1.12%. The volatility ratio for the week is 2.83% while the volatility levels for the last 30 days are 4.00% for Daqo New Energy Corp. The simple moving average for the last 20 days is 2.76% for DQ stock, with a simple moving average of -14.53% for the last 200 days.
Analysts’ Opinion of DQ
Many brokerage firms have already submitted their reports for DQ stocks, with Nomura repeating the rating for DQ by listing it as a “Buy.” The predicted price for DQ in the upcoming period, according to Nomura is $45 based on the research report published on August 04, 2023 of the current year 2023.

Stock Fundamentals for DQ
Current profitability levels for the company are sitting at:
- +66.05 for the present operating margin
- +73.95 for the gross margin
The net margin for Daqo New Energy Corp. stands at +39.49. The total capital return value is set at 65.53, while invested capital returns managed to touch 52.22. Equity return is now at value 21.80, with 13.80 for asset returns.
Based on Daqo New Energy Corp. (DQ), the company’s capital structure generated 0.43 points at debt to equity in total, while total debt to capital is 0.43.
When we switch over and look at the enterprise to sales, we see a ratio of -0.22, with the company’s debt to enterprise value settled at 0.02. The receivables turnover for the company is 6.15 and the total asset turnover is 0.84. The liquidity ratio also appears to be rather interesting for investors as it stands at 6.64.
